# Building Access — Door Sensor Recall (Contractors)

The Veltrix door sensors on the Calder Annex entrances are under recall and have been disabled pending replacement. Badge taps at the annex will not register until the new units arrive next week. Contractors should continue signing in at the Harwick Court reception as usual. For the duration of the recall, the annex side door operates on a keypad instead of badge readers. Enter through that door using the interim access code shown below.

door code, tagef-bajop: bdg-SB-7

## 3.2.0 — Setting renamed

MagnaDiff now calls the chunked-rendering flag DIFF_STREAM_MODE (was BIGFILE_MODE). Plugin authors: update manifests before 3.3, the old name is ignored silently. Hook signatures are unchanged. Plugins fetching remote diff baselines still need the registry credential in their env file. The line below sets it.

vault entry, yajof-yajeg: VAULT_KEY3=164

## Alert: ScanBridge Decode Failure Rate Elevated

This alert fires when Tillhouse registers report barcode decode failures above 5% over ten minutes. Common causes include a stale symbology profile pushed by Lanecraft provisioning or a firmware mismatch on Orino handheld scanners. Before escalating, confirm whether failures cluster on one store or span the fleet, and capture two sample scan logs. If the issue spans multiple sites, notify the integrations team at the address below.

pager mailbox: quenael@zemvarsys.internal

All component snapshots in the Lumenhart UI Kit are generated deterministically and committed under `__snaps__/`. For security review purposes, note that snapshot diffs are validated in CI before any visual baseline is promoted. Baselines are signed at promotion time so that downstream consumers can verify no snapshot was altered outside the pipeline. The verification step in `verify-baselines.sh` checks each archive against the team's published key. For reference during your audit, the current deploy key is included below.

release key, yagap-kagag: bky6_1ks93y

CI Troubleshooting — Calindra Date Localization

Plugin authors: if locale-formatted date tests fail in CI but pass locally, the runner's timezone database likely predates your locale pack. Pin the Calindra base image rather than patching formats by hand. When reporting the failure, quote the build token that appears directly below.

pipeline stamp: htk4_ae36